Ask HN: Using LLMs for Better Design in Front End Development?
Dec 17, 2024 · news.ycombinator.comResponses vary, with some suggesting that LLMs are not suitable for design improvements as they lack the ability to follow specific style or design guidelines, making design still a human task. Others argue that while LLMs cannot innovate or be creative, they can provide a generic polish by predicting designs based on existing patterns. This could be beneficial for those without established style guidelines, offering a starting point for cohesive design, though not a complete solution.
